Regency and Georgian Country Dancing

The Old School Room, St Peters Church First Turn, Oxford, Oxford

Fine dancing, I believe, like virtue, must be its own reward – Emma by Jane Austen 1815Georgettes of Oxford is delighted to offer Regency and Georgian Country dance classes on two Friday evenings a month in the Parish Room at St Peter’s Church, Wolvercote. Over this term we shall be focusing on learning more dances […]
